      We used airbnb. which was a pretty funny situation. we booked a place for super cheap! like 80 euro a night. it was beautiful, a bit of a walk, but had a balcony overlooking the old town of dubrovnik. it was clean too. But they overbooked us! Airbnb found us a solution right away and totally upgraded us to a place that was 150 euro a night. we had a private terrace, and we were right in old town. and air conditioning. we went from a very old place to a very modern place. it was a nice little change! here's all the dubrovnik ones on airbnb... i'd definitely do that again! they'll take care of you if anything goes wrong. http://www.airbnb.com/s/Dubrovnik--Croatia
